Linfield College is a private, comprehensive liberal arts institution with a main campus in McMinnville, a second campus in Portland, and one of the best online colleges in Oregon. Combined, these locations enroll more than 2,500 students every year, representing 24 states and 23 countries. Students have been pursuing distance education programs at Linfield since 1975. Currently, the college offers ten online undergraduate degrees, five minors, and 19 certificates. Students can choose from more than two dozen diverse areas of study, including computer information systems, environmental studies, wine marketing, and creative writing. Linfield allows eligible students to earn up to 30 credits for prior learning and experience. All students receive access to a virtual writing lab and live tutoring. To apply, prospective students must provide official transcripts; a $50 fee; and information regarding academic history, employment, and personal background. State residency does not impact tuition costs.

Acceptance Rate Insight
82% of students were accepted during the 2020-2021 school year. Sometimes schools with midrange acceptance rates have higher standards of entry but are still accessible to many students who apply.
Retention Rate Insight
85% of full-time students stayed to continue their studies the following academic year. These students started in Fall 2019 and returned in Fall 2020.
Graduation Rate Insight
69% of students graduated out of all full-time, first-time students who began their studies in Fall 2014. Keep in mind many students who enroll are not typically first-time students, as most are adult learners. Therefore, the number of first-time students is traditionally low.
